Skip to content

BOSSincrypto/aml-chainalysis

Repository files navigation

AML Checker

Проверка криптовалютных адресов на санкции и риски с использованием Chainalysis API.

Возможности

  • Проверка адресов на санкции OFAC
  • Поддержка множества блокчейн-сетей (Bitcoin, Ethereum, BSC, Polygon, и др.)
  • Оценка уровня риска
  • История проверок
  • Русскоязычный интерфейс

Настройка API ключа

  1. Получите API ключ от Chainalysis: https://www.chainalysis.com/free-cryptocurrency-sanctions-screening-tools/
  2. Создайте файл .env в корне проекта:
    VITE_CHAINALYSIS_API_KEY=your_api_key_here
    

Локальная разработка

npm install
npm run dev

Деплой на GitHub Pages

  1. Создайте новый репозиторий на GitHub с именем aml-checker
  2. Загрузите код в репозиторий:
    git remote add origin https://github.com/YOUR_USERNAME/aml-checker.git
    git push -u origin main
  3. В настройках репозитория (Settings > Secrets and variables > Actions) добавьте секрет:
    • Name: VITE_CHAINALYSIS_API_KEY
    • Value: ваш API ключ от Chainalysis
  4. В настройках репозитория (Settings > Pages):
    • Source: GitHub Actions
  5. GitHub Actions автоматически задеплоит сайт при каждом пуше в main

Сайт будет доступен по адресу: https://YOUR_USERNAME.github.io/aml-checker/

Технологии

  • React + TypeScript
  • Vite
  • Tailwind CSS
  • shadcn/ui
  • Chainalysis Sanctions Screening API

About

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ages